Notice Title

Resource Efficient Supply and Manufacturing Environment (RESuME)

Notice Description

RESuME will be the first National Manufacturing Institute for Scotland (NMIS) test bed to be detailed and developed. Test beds are essential to address known and specific industrial challenges, but also to illustrate and demonstrate the potential from manufacturing technology to a wider audience NMIS test beds will address integration challenges which go beyond the more specific potential from foundational processing technologies and illustrate potential at the enterprise level. In most cases the test beds represent supply chain approaches and in some cases demonstrators which extend through the Scottish Industrial landscape. RESuME is designed to illustrate the combined capabilities of the Advanced Forming Research Centre (AFRC) in metallic and composite processing technology and NMIS capabilities in digital technology, design and make, and supply chain agility. Scope of supply: > provision of the integrated platform > hardware > integration and development services > support > training
